#469059 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#469059 is composed of 27.5% red, 56.5%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.2% yellow and 43.5% black. It has a hue angle of 135.4 degrees, a saturation of 34.6% and a lightness of 42%. #469059 color hex could be obtained by blending #8cffb2 with #002100.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#469059 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#469059 has RGB values of R:70, G:144, B:89 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:0, Y:0.38,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 4624473.

Shades and Tints of #469059

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060c07 is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#469059

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#676f69 is the less saturated color, while #04d239 is the most saturated one.
